Analysis
Luxembourg recorded 21.1% for multidimensional poverty headcount ratio, female in 2020.
That represents a change of down 2.3% on the previous year and up 19.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, multidimensional poverty headcount ratio, female in Luxembourg peaked at 23.6% in 2018 and was at its lowest, 17.7%, in 2010.
That places Luxembourg 19th out of 36 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.
Multidimensional poverty headcount ratio, female in Luxembourg, year by year
| Year | % of female population |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 17.7% | — |
| 2011 | 18.0% | +1.7% |
| 2012 | 19.4% | +7.8% |
| 2013 | 19.4% | +0.0% |
| 2014 | 19.5% | +0.5% |
| 2015 | 19.3% | -1.0% |
| 2016 | 20.9% | +8.3% |
| 2017 | 22.8% | +9.1% |
| 2018 | 23.6% | +3.5% |
| 2019 | 21.6% | -8.5% |
| 2020 | 21.1% | -2.3% |
